An intermediate level, interactive on-line class that focuses on the identification, assessment and treatment of the multiple factors that affect self-regulation. Children with self-regulation dysfunction tend to have behavioral breakdowns and present with inconsistency in skills that are perplexing and limiting to functional output.
Participants will gain an understanding of how the factors connect and interact with each other and will learn practical and specific strategies to address each of the problem areas that you can begin to apply immediately. The information provided is highly effective for addressing these inconsistencies in behavior. Upon completion, participants will have multiple strategies to apply when treating this elusive problem. This class will prepare you to treat and assess children with self-regulation dysfunction.
